Oyo State Government Boosts Healthcare with Solar Energy Installation at Oranmiyan Primary Healthcare Center

The Oyo State Government, led by Governor Seyi Makinde, has made significant progress in enhancing healthcare services through the installation of a 10kW solar power project at the Oranmiyan Primary Healthcare Center in Ibadan South East LGA.

This initiative, commissioned in 2021 by the Ministry of Energy and Mineral Resources, demonstrates the government’s commitment to providing reliable and uninterrupted electricity to healthcare facilities.

According to a Facebook post by the Oyo State Commissioner for Energy and Mineral Resources, Barr. Temilolu Nurudeen Seun Ashamu, the Oranmiyan project is one of 23 similar installations implemented by the current administration.

This project underscores the state government’s dedication to leveraging sustainable energy solutions to enhance public services and improve the quality of life for its citizens.

“Since its commissioning, the solar installation has benefited over 500 patients annually, including more than 200 from the maternity ward. The provision of consistent electricity has substantially improved healthcare delivery, eliminating the power outages that previously compromised service quality at the center.

The Oyo State Government’s innovative approach to healthcare and energy reflects a broader vision for sustainable development and effective governance, ensuring that essential services are resilient and accessible to all.”
